
INK is a fast-paced platformer about using colorful paint to uncover your surroundings. Defeat all enemies in the room and reach the goal! However, the terrain is invisible, so you need to discover the terrain by physically bumping into it, by performing a double jump or by, well, dying.

Cool idea. Visually very appealing. The description says 'fast-paced' and 'hardcore' platforming, which I'm fine with, but I didn't expect the controls to be so imprecise. The feeling is that your avatar is sliding around constantly (as some games might do with surfaces being coated in ice), so it's very hard to time your movements appropriately even on the easiest levels. I may give it another go - I only got up to level 15 - but I don't think it's worth the frustration. I wouldn't call this a 'bad game', but it's very much not for me.
